Recognizes a protein of 95kDa, which is identified as villin. It is a major constituent in the microvilli, which compose the brush border of epithelial cells forming absorptive surfaces of the intestinal and renal proximal tubular epithelia. Anti-Villin labels the brush border area in the gastrointestinal mucosal epithelium and urogenital tract. Among neoplasms, villin is predominantly expressed in tumors of colorectal origin. Antibody to villin is useful in identifying malignant cells from primary and metastatic colorectal carcinomas. This antibody also labels Merkel cells of the skin.
Optimal dilution of the Villin antibody should be determined by the researcher.
A recombinant partial protein sequence (within amino acids 600-700) from the human protein was used as the immunogen for the Villin antibody.
Aliquot the Villin antibody and store frozen at -20oC or colder.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
